The Ant target gwt-shell in drools-guvnor/build.xml sounded promising,
but when I tried to run it, it got this error

Could not load definitions from resource de/samaflost/gwttasks/antlib.xml. It 
could not be found.

That is coming from this taskdef:

            <taskdef uri="antlib:de.samaflost.gwttasks"
                          resource="de/samaflost/gwttasks/antlib.xml"
                          classpath="../lib/gwttasks.jar"/>

Relative to drools-guvnor, there is no ../lib.

I searched for gwttasks.jar in the Drools source and in the
GWT (1.7.1) distribution but didn't find it.
